Preparing online bookings for fulfillment

This guide explains how to efficiently prepare and manage online bookings for fulfillment in TWICE Commerce, ensuring smooth operations and excellent customer service.

Preparing online bookings in advance is a great way to optimize the usage of your time and ensure fast customer service for customers who have booked their rentals online.

Accessing and Reviewing Bookings

  1. Navigate to Orders > Upcoming to view all future bookings
  2. Click on any order to view its details
  3. Review customer information and booking specifics
  4. Check for any special requirements or notes

Preparing Orders for Fulfillment

Assign Specific Items

  1. Open the order details
  2. Locate the product list
  3. Click the dropdown menu next to each item or use barcode scanners to input article IDs into the order.

Learn more about utilizing barcode scanners in your daily operations

Mark Orders as Prepared

  1. Review all assigned items
  2. Check the "Prepared" box in the right panel when you have inspected, adjusted, and prepared all the items for pick up or shipment.
  3. The order will now display a "Prepared" tag in the Upcoming Orders list

Print Order Documentation

  • For individual customers: Click the printer icon on the customer card
  • For groups: Select the printer icon in the top right corner of the page
Tip: Even for groups, it's a good practice to print out the individual customer confirmations and attach printed documents to the prepared equipment. This helps with the identification of the right equipment.

Best Practices

Organization

  • Designate a specific area or shelf/rack space for prepared equipment
  • Organize prepared items by pickup time/date
  • Attach printed order confirmations to the prepared equipment

Quality Control

Before marking an order as "Prepared":

  • Double-check that article IDs match the order requirements
  • Verify all items are in excellent condition
  • Ensure all accessories or add-ons are included and easily available

Regular Monitoring

  • Review upcoming orders daily
  • Prepare orders in advance when possible
  • Check for last-minute changes or updates

Important Notes

  • Online bookings appear alongside admin and walk-in rentals in the upcoming orders view
  • The preparation process is the same regardless of the booking source — new orders appear on the upcoming orders table from where the staff members pick orders for fulfilment.
